Iron Man's new Hellbuster armor makes his Hulkbuster suit look basic
Iron Man gets a hellish upgrade with his Hellbuster armor that he'll don in The Infernal Hulk #6, and we have an exclusive look

What does Tony Stark have in common with the most dedicated cosplayers at a pop culture convention? They're both always working on something, usually some form of armor. God forbid a man have hobbies!
Iron Man's habit of tinkering will work to save both his life and soul in Marvel Comics' upcoming Infernal Hulk #6, which marks the debut of his Hellbuster armor. Written by Phillip Kennedy Johnson, with art by Nic Klein, The Infernal Hulk #6 will put Avenger against Avenger as "Iron Man leads an overpowered strike force to level the Living City and end the Age of Monsters forever," as per Marvel's synopsis of the issue, which also asks, "Will Tony's new Hellbuster Armor and the spear of the One Above All be enough to keep him alive against the Infernal Hulk? Or will he be corrupted like all the others?"
The issue - which continues the story of a Hulk possessed by The Eldest, an ancient horror that has replaced Bruce Banner as the alter ego of the Strongest One There Is - will hit stands this April. Feast your eyes upon Nic Klein's glorious cover for the issue:

Klein's cover is an homage to the Archangel Michael slaying Satan in the form of a serpent, one of the most enduring images in Christian art. The imagery is apt because, well, we're talking about The Infernal Hulk here, after all - and it also sets the stage for what I would imagine will be one of the greatest fights that either character has been a part of. (Which, considering Tony Stark has previously built an armor called The Hulkbuster, is really saying something.) It's no secret that Tony Stark has dealt with his fair share of demons in the past, so how will his new descent compare to his past trials and tribulations? See how it all shakes out in just a handful of months.
The Infernal Hulk #6 will be released on April 15, 2026.
